AbstractSince 1991 the “slimming industry” has grown rapidly in the Czech Republic. A survey among participants in a nationwide health education program (“Losing weight in a reasonable way”) showed that an alarmingly high number of women are using dangerous methods to lose weight. A study among female university students revealed similar unhealthy practices related to the highly prevalent desire to be slimmer. The findings point to the difficult question: What kind of health education is helpful to prevent overweight without increasing the risk for the development of eating disorders?
